Does your vehicle have cameras or driver-assistance technology fitted around the windscreen?
Modern vehicles often use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S) to support features such as lane keeping, forward collision warnings and automatic emergency braking. When these systems use a camera mounted near the windscreen, replacing the windscreen can affect the position of that camera.
In some vehicles, ADAS calibration may be required after windscreen replacement to ensure the camera and associated safety systems are correctly aligned.

what is adas?
ADAS stands for Advanced Driver Assistance Systems.
These are electronic safety systems designed to assist drivers by using cameras, sensors and other technology to monitor the road and the vehicle's surroundings.
Depending on the vehicle, ADAS can support features such as lane departure warnings, lane keeping assistance, forward collision warnings, automatic emergency braking, traffic sign recognition, adaptive cruise control and other camera-based driver assistance features.
The technology and calibration requirements vary between vehicle makes, models and systems.

ADAS Calibration After Collision Repairs
ADAS calibration may also be required following collision repairs or accident damage.
Depending on the vehicle and the repairs carried out, calibration may be required to ensure the relevant cameras and sensors are correctly aligned.
